Tip your favourite themed UK trail for the chance to win a holiday voucher


A themed trail can turn a walk into an adventure, keep children occupied and be educational, too – and we’re keen to hear your favourites. Whether it’s a child-friendly Gruffalo trail or an arty route following sculptures along the coast, a literary trail tracing the haunts of an author, or a historic walk, we want to know about it. They might be trails you’ve found in a guidebook, downloaded on an app or invented yourself – send us the web link if necessary.

If you have a relevant photo, do send it in – but it’s your words that will be judged for the competition.

Keep your tip to about 100 words

The best tip of the week, chosen by Tom Hall of Lonely Planet, will win a £200 voucher to stay at a Sawday’s property – the company has more than 3,000 in the UK and Europe. The best tips will appear on the Guardian Travel website, and maybe in the paper, too.

We’re sorry, but for legal reasons you must be a UK resident to enter this competition.

The competition closes on 29 June at 9am BST
